Bhubaneswar: A day after witnessing 1264 COVID-19 cases, Odisha reported yet another record spike with 1594 fresh cases in the last 24 hours. With this, the total coronavirus infection tally in Odisha reached 22693 on Friday. This is the third consecutive day that the State has reported 1000-plus COVID-19 cases.

Of the new cases, 1067 were detected from quarantine centres while 527 are local contacts. Ganjam recorded 732 new cases while next in line are Khurda and Cuttack districts with 320 cases and 136 cases, respectively. Bhadrak witnessed 60 new cases, Boudh (41) while 33 cases were detected from Koraput.

As per official reports, six persons succumbed to coronavirus in the last 24 hours, taking the COVID-19 death toll in Odisha to 120.

Among the six Covid positive patients who died of the infection is a 44-year-old male of Ganjam district who was also suffering from diabetes, a 71-year-old male of Rayagada district who was also suffering from diabetes, Hypertension and Chronic Kidney disease, a 53-year-old male of Gajapati district, a 59-year-old female of Ganjam district, a 50-year-old female of Ganjam district and a 60-year-old male of Bhadrak district who was also suffering from Diabetes and Hypertension.

Two more Covid positive patients in State died due to other health complications.

So far, 14,393 patients have recovered from the disease, while active case count stands at 8148.
